数据库分层依据是什么格式
-
数据库分层依据可以根据以下几种格式进行划分:
-
逻辑层次:根据数据的逻辑关系和功能进行划分。这种分层方式将数据库划分为多个逻辑层次,每个层次负责一组相关的数据和相关的操作。常见的逻辑层次包括用户层、应用层、逻辑层和物理层。
-
数据模型层次:根据数据模型进行划分。常见的数据模型包括层次模型、网状模型和关系模型。根据不同的数据模型,可以将数据库划分为不同的层次。
-
存储层次:根据数据的存储方式进行划分。常见的存储方式包括文件存储、块存储和记录存储。根据不同的存储方式,可以将数据库划分为不同的层次。
-
安全层次:根据数据的安全性要求进行划分。常见的安全层次包括公开层、保密层和机密层。根据不同的安全要求,可以将数据库划分为不同的层次。
-
性能层次:根据数据的性能要求进行划分。常见的性能层次包括高性能层、普通性能层和低性能层。根据不同的性能要求,可以将数据库划分为不同的层次。
通过以上不同的分层方式,可以将数据库划分为多个层次,从而提高数据库的管理和维护效率,同时也可以更好地满足不同用户和应用的需求。
1年前 -
-
数据库分层依据并没有固定的格式,它是根据数据库设计的需求和目标来确定的。然而,以下是一些常见的数据库分层依据的格式:
-
逻辑分层:数据库可以根据逻辑功能进行分层,常见的逻辑分层包括数据访问层、业务逻辑层和数据存储层。数据访问层负责与外部系统的交互,业务逻辑层负责处理业务逻辑,数据存储层负责存储和管理数据。
-
物理分层:数据库可以根据物理存储方式进行分层,常见的物理分层包括数据文件层、数据块层和页层。数据文件层负责管理数据文件的存储和管理,数据块层负责将数据文件划分为适当的块,页层负责将数据块划分为适当的页。
-
数据模型分层:数据库可以根据数据模型进行分层,常见的数据模型分层包括概念模型、逻辑模型和物理模型。概念模型描述了数据的整体结构和关系,逻辑模型描述了数据的逻辑组织和操作,物理模型描述了数据的物理存储方式和访问方法。
-
安全分层:数据库可以根据安全需求进行分层,常见的安全分层包括用户认证层、访问控制层和数据加密层。用户认证层负责验证用户身份,访问控制层负责控制用户对数据的访问权限,数据加密层负责对敏感数据进行加密保护。
总之,数据库分层的依据可以根据不同的需求和目标来确定,可以根据逻辑功能、物理存储方式、数据模型和安全需求等方面进行分层。这样的分层设计可以提高数据库的可维护性、可扩展性和安全性。
1年前 -
-
数据库的分层依据通常是根据数据库的功能和数据访问方式来确定的。下面是一种常见的数据库分层格式:
-
数据层:负责数据的存储和管理。该层包括数据库服务器、存储设备和相关的管理工具。数据库服务器负责处理数据的增删改查操作,并提供高可用性和性能优化的功能。存储设备用于存储数据库的数据文件和日志文件。
-
应用层:负责处理业务逻辑和数据访问。该层包括应用服务器和应用程序。应用服务器负责接收用户的请求,调用相应的应用程序进行业务处理,并返回结果给用户。应用程序负责处理业务逻辑,包括数据验证、计算、数据转换等操作。
-
接口层:负责与外部系统进行数据交互。该层包括接口程序和接口协议。接口程序负责将数据从数据库中提取出来,并按照接口协议的规定格式进行转换和传输。接口协议定义了数据的格式、传输方式和安全性等要求。
-
用户层:负责与用户进行交互。该层包括用户界面和用户操作。用户界面提供给用户进行数据输入和查询的界面,可以是图形界面、命令行界面或者Web界面等。用户操作包括用户的登录、注册、数据查询和修改等操作。
在实际应用中,数据库的分层结构可以根据具体需求进行调整和扩展。例如,可以将数据层进一步划分为主数据库和备份数据库,实现数据的冗余和灾备。另外,还可以引入缓存层、搜索引擎层等组件来提高系统的性能和扩展性。
1年前 -